Course Content

• Health Promotion Planning and Evaluation
• Health Policy and Advocacy for Reform
• Social Determinants of Health and Health Inequalities
• Community Engagement and Participation in Health Promotion
• Theories and Models of Health Behaviour Change
• Health Promotion Program Design and Implementation
• Monitoring and Evaluation of Health Promotion Interventions
• Digital Health Promotion and Communication Strategies
• Health Economics and Resource Allocation in Health Promotion Reform

Career path

Career Role (Health Promotion) Description
Health Promotion Specialist Develops and implements health improvement programs; strong communication & project management skills are vital.
Public Health Consultant Provides expert advice on health issues; requires advanced knowledge of health policy and data analysis.
Health Promotion Officer Works within communities to improve health and wellbeing; excellent interpersonal and community engagement skills are essential.
Health Improvement Practitioner Supports individuals and groups to make positive lifestyle changes; requires strong counseling and motivational interviewing skills.
